Spinach Strawberry Salad

Ingredients:

  • 2 T. sesame seed
  • 1 T. poppy seed
  • 1 1/2 t. minced onion
  • 1/4 t. worcestershire sauce
  • 1/4 t. paprika
  • 1/4 c. cider vinegar
  • 1/2 c. oil
  • 1/2 c. sugar or Splenda
  • 1 bunch spinach
  • 2 cups sliced strawberries
  • 1/4 cup slivered almonds

Directions:

  1. Place sesame seed, poppy seed, onion, worcestershire sauce, paprika, vinegar, and sugar in a blender.  Add oil in a steady stream with blender on low speed.  Blend until creamy and thick.
  2. Combine spinach, strawberries and almonds in a large bowl.  Drizzle a moderate amount of dressing over the top; toss to coat.  Add more dressing if desired.

Extra dressing can refrigerated for later use.
